Enhance Garden Seclusion with Unique Landscaping

Posted on 20/07/2024

In today's fast-paced world, having a secluded space to unwind is more important than ever. Gardens can offer a sanctuary from daily stress, but achieving the right balance between beauty and privacy can be challenging. This article explores the art of enhancing garden seclusion with unique landscaping techniques. Whether you have a sprawling yard or a compact urban garden, these ideas will help you create your private oasis.


The Importance of Garden Seclusion


Privacy in your garden allows you to relax, meditate, and entertain guests without the watchful eyes of neighbors or passers-by. A secluded garden offers a personal retreat where you can reconnect with nature, which has numerous mental and physical health benefits. Seclusion also adds a layer of security, giving you peace of mind as you enjoy your outdoor space.

Creative Landscaping Ideas for Enhanced Seclusion


Here are some innovative landscaping ideas that will help you achieve that secluded paradise you've always wanted in your backyard.


Natural Fencing with Trees and Shrubs

Using trees and shrubs to form a natural fence is one of the most effective ways to gain privacy. Opt for fast-growing plants like bamboo, arborvitae, or leylandii. These species not only provide a thick barrier but also add lush greenery to your garden. For a layered look, mix different plant heights and textures.


Incorporating Vertical Gardens

Vertical gardens are ideal for small spaces or urban gardens. They not only maximize your gardening area but also create a lush wall that blocks unwanted views. Opt for climbing plants like ivy, jasmine, or clematis mixed with vertical planters filled with ferns, herbs, and flowers.


Strategic Use of Water Features

Water features like fountains, ponds, or waterfalls serve as excellent focal points while also providing auditory privacy. The sound of running water drowns out noise from neighbors or nearby streets, making your garden feel more secluded and peaceful.


Utilizing Structures for Seclusion


Building Pergolas and Gazebos

Structures like pergolas, gazebos, or arbors can create a shaded, private nook in your garden. Add climbing plants like wisteria or grapevines to these structures for additional privacy and aesthetic appeal. They serve as excellent spots for outdoor dining or lounging.


Creating Secluded Sitting Areas

Design sitting areas tucked away from the main garden, surrounded by tall plants, trellises, or lattices. Place benches, chairs, and tables to create functional, yet private spaces. Add outdoor cushions and throws for comfort.


Using Decorative Elements for Privacy


Privacy Screens and Panels

Decorative screens and panels can add an artistic element to your garden while enhancing privacy. Choose materials like wood, metal, or bamboo, and select designs that complement your garden's aesthetic. These screens can be mobile, allowing you to rearrange them as needed.


Incorporating Garden Art

Use garden art, sculptures, or large pots to create visual barriers and focal points. These elements not only contribute to the garden's aesthetics but also disrupt direct views into your space, offering an added layer of seclusion.


Pros and Cons of Enhancing Garden Seclusion


Pros:



    • Increased Privacy: Enjoy your garden space without intrusion.

    • Enhanced Aesthetics: Unique landscaping techniques add beauty to your garden.

    • Noise Reduction: Water features and dense foliage can reduce ambient noise.

    • Added Security: Secluded gardens are less inviting to trespassers.



Cons:



    • Maintenance: High-maintenance plants and structures may require regular upkeep.

    • Cost: Some landscaping elements can be expensive to install.

    • Space Limitations: Small gardens may struggle to incorporate certain features.

    • Time: Establishing a secluded garden may take months or even years to mature.



Tips for Creating a Secluded Garden



    • Plan Ahead: Sketch a layout before starting your project.

    • Budget Wisely: Set a realistic budget to avoid overspending.

    • Choose Fast-Growing Plants: Select plants that will quickly establish privacy.

    • Mix and Match: Combine different elements for a diversified look.

    • Maintain Regularly: Keep your garden in top condition with consistent care.
